Injunctions Sought Against E-cig Manufacturers as FDA Steps Up Enforcement

The US Department of Justice has taken legal action against six e-cigarette manufacturers on behalf of the US Food and Drug Administration. 

Morin Enterprises Inc. (doing business as E-Cig Crib), Soul Vapor, Super Vape’z, Vapor Craft, Lucky’s Convenience & Tobacco, and Seditious Vapours failed to submit the necessary premarket applications for their e-cigarette products “and have continued to illegally manufacture, sell, and distribute their products, despite previous warning from the FDA that they were in violation of the law,” the FDA said in a statement issued October 18, 2022.

The flurry of complaints marked the first time the FDA has taken this step against e-cigarette manufacturers to enforce its premarket review requirements for new tobacco products.

“We will not stand by as manufacturers repeatedly break the law,” said Brian King, director of the FDA’s Center for Tobacco Products.
